Tonasket girl's volleyball team earns awards

TONASKET – At the Tonasket girl’s volleyball banquet on Nov. 14, several players were given awards they had earned throughout the season.

Senior Amber Allen was named Most Valuable Player while Kellilynn Vanatta was named Most Improved Player. Sophomore Jessica Rhoads was named Most Inspirational Player and junior Falisha Laurie won the Sportsmanship Award.

Senior Megan McKinney won the Coaches Award while Jayden Hawkins won the JV Coaches Award and Mackenzie Wheeler won the C-Squad Coaches Award.

Senior Cierra Silverthorn and senior Jessica Kitterman both won the Special Award for Perfect Attendance for four years. Silverthorn also made the CTL All-League second team while Allen and Kitterman each earned the CTL All-League Honorable Mention.
